Aerodactyl/Dragonite Dual Mega Offense

DoublesRegulation Set M-B

Synergy

Double Tailwind from Aerodactyl and Dragonite lets either Mega lead the sweep, while Dragonite's Haze answers setup teams and clears its own Make It Rain drops on Gholdengo, and the anti-Charizard core of two Megas plus Life Orb Gholdengo covers the format's most common threat.

Win Conditions

Whichever Mega gets to set Tailwind first opens the door for King Gambit, Basculegion, and Sneasler to sweep. Gholdengo's Life Orb Make It Rain threatens Floette and Sylveon directly while Dragonite's Haze neutralizes any opposing setup that stalls the game out.

Lead Options

Aerodactyl + Dragonite, Gholdengo + Dragonite

Not detailed explicitly in the video. This Aerodactyl trades the bulk seen on the Rank #1 team for a maximum offense spread, meaning it hits harder and outpaces rival Aerodactyl but is more exposed to the physical pressure a bulkier build would otherwise shrug off.

Team Export
Mega Dragonite @ Dragoninite
Ability: Multiscale
Modest Nature
Level: 50
EVs: 32 HP / 25 SpA / 5 SpD / 4 Spe
- Draco Meteor
- Thunderbolt
- Haze
- Tailwind

Gholdengo @ Life Orb
Ability: Good as Gold
Modest Nature
Level: 50
EVs: 7 HP / 8 Def / 32 SpA / 19 Spe
- Make It Rain
- Shadow Ball
- Thunderbolt
- Protect

Mega Aerodactyl @ Aerodactylite
Ability: Unnerve
Jolly Nature
Level: 50
EVs: 32 Atk / 2 SpD / 32 Spe
- Rock Slide
- Ice Fang
- Dual Wingbeat
- Tailwind

Kingambit @ Chople Berry
Ability: Defiant
Adamant Nature
Level: 50
EVs: 32 HP / 25 Atk / 9 Spe
- Kowtow Cleave
- Sucker Punch
- Low Kick
- Protect

Basculegion @ Focus Sash
Ability: Adaptability
Adamant Nature
Level: 50
EVs: 2 HP / 32 Atk / 32 Spe
- Liquidation
- Last Respects
- Protect
- Aqua Jet

Sneasler @ White Herb
Ability: Unburden
Jolly Nature
Level: 50
EVs: 32 Atk / 2 SpD / 32 Spe
- Dire Claw
- Close Combat
- Fake Out
- Protect
